Dutch-Moldovan Business Forum: Netherlands Ranks THIRD Among Moldova’s Top Investors

According to data from the Public Services Agency, there are currently 144 Dutch-owned companies operating in the Republic of Moldova, with investments in share capital totaling 2.6 billion lei.

The first Moldovan-Dutch business forum, aimed at stimulating and developing trade relations between Moldova and the Netherlands, is taking place these days in Chișinău.

Participants at the event are interacting with government officials, and entrepreneurs from Moldova and abroad, presenting their investment offers, exploring the economic potential of the market, and establishing long-term partnerships.

The forum was organized with the support of the Embassy of the Netherlands and the Investment Agency, and it has attracted dozens of Dutch companies interested in the Moldovan market, as well as Moldovan companies that export or intend to sell their goods in the Netherlands.
